The Department of Homeland Security (DHS), Office of Procurement Operations (OPO), Federal Protective Service (FPS) is issuing this request for proposals (RFP) to solicit offers for the purpose of awarding a contract to provide Armed Protective Security Officer (PSO) services for Customs and Border Protection (CBP) facilities throughout Puerto Rico.

This requirement is solicited as a commercial item in accordance with FAR Part 12. Services shall be furnished via an Indefinite Delivery/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) contract with fixed hourly rates. It is anticipated that this requirement will be issued as an 8(a) Small Business Set-Aside. Resultant task orders under this contract will be firm fixed prices. The source selection process to be utilized for this acquisition is best value/trade-off.

The technical, non-price factors, when combined, are more important than price. The Contractor shall provide all labor, material, management, supervision, training, licenses, and permits to provide the services in accordance with the Statement of Work (SOW). The estimated PSO basic service hours and Temporary Additional Services (TAS) for the CBP facilities throughout Puerto Rico is 750,000 hours (150,000 hours annually) for a 60-month period.

The North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) code for this acquisition is 561612, Security Guard and Patrol Services. The size standard for NAICS 561612 is $29 million in average annual receipts. The contract will be awarded for a five-year term, consisting of annual ordering/performance periods.
